The field of biotechnology, often referred to as the bio tech sector, is a rapidly evolving industry that combines biology, technology, and innovation to revolutionize the way we approach healthcare, agriculture, and environmental sustainability. From developing new treatments for diseases to improving crop yields and creating sustainable biofuels, the biotech sector plays a crucial role in shaping the future of our planet.
Biotechnology encompasses a wide range of disciplines, including molecular biology, genetics, biochemistry, and microbiology. By leveraging the latest advancements in science and technology, biotech companies are able to manipulate biological systems at the molecular level to develop new products and processes that have the potential to improve human health and well-being.
One of the key areas where biotechnology has made significant strides is in the field of medicine. Biotech companies are at the forefront of developing cutting-edge treatments for a wide range of diseases, including cancer, genetic disorders, and infectious diseases. Through genetic engineering, researchers are able to create targeted therapies that can attack diseased cells while leaving healthy cells unharmed, leading to more effective and less toxic treatments for patients.
Another area where the biotech sector is making a major impact is in agriculture. By developing genetically modified seeds that are resistant to pests and disease, biotech companies are helping farmers increase their crop yields and reduce the need for harmful pesticides and herbicides. Additionally, biotech companies are working on developing drought-resistant crops that can thrive in harsh environmental conditions, helping to ensure global food security in the face of climate change.
In addition to medicine and agriculture, the biotech sector is also playing a key role in developing sustainable alternatives to fossil fuels. Through the use of biotechnology, researchers are able to produce biofuels from renewable sources such as algae, corn, and sugarcane. These biofuels are cleaner and more sustainable than traditional fossil fuels, helping to reduce greenhouse gas emissions and combat climate change.
The biotech sector is a hotbed of innovation, with new advancements and breakthroughs occurring on a daily basis. One area of research that is currently generating a lot of excitement is CRISPR-Cas9 gene editing technology. This revolutionary tool allows researchers to make precise changes to the DNA of plants, animals, and even humans, opening up endless possibilities for treating genetic disorders and creating new and improved products.
Despite the many opportunities and advancements in the biotech sector, there are also challenges and ethical considerations that must be addressed. As biotechnology continues to push the boundaries of what is possible, questions arise about the ethics of gene editing, the safety of genetically modified organisms, and the potential for misuse of biotechnologies for nefarious purposes. It is important for biotech companies to engage in open and transparent dialogue with the public and policymakers to ensure that their research is conducted ethically and responsibly.
